Cutting Edge: A Course in Fashion Design, July 12 - 16, 2010
You are a designer at heart. You pore over fashion magazines and scour the mall for the latest fashions, styles, textures, and fabrics. Now it’s time to take it to the next level. Learn how to take your ideas and turn them into wearable pieces of art.
In this course you will work with lo cal designer and CVA Alumna Carly Stipe. You will study proportion and the human form, color illustrations of your designs, discuss pattern making, and use non-traditional materials and construction techniques.
We will have a fashion show on Friday, July 16. Knowledge of sewing is not mandatory. Students are required to bring a bag lunch.

Let the Light In: B&W and Pinhole Photography, June 21 - 25, 2010
This is your chance to explore traditional black and white film and darkroom processes with CVA Alumna Caroline Houdek. Learn how to use the darkroom by making cameraless photographs called photograms. You'll also make a p inhole camera you will use to create black and white photographs without using film! Then use the 35mm camera and film to take pictures you will develop and print yourself.
Students will need to bring their own 35mm film camera to use for the class. Students are also required to bring a bag lunch.
